Family-Friendly 7-Day Itinerary in New Zealand

Monday, January 22: Exploring the Vibrant City of Auckland

Start your trip in the cosmopolitan city of Auckland. In the morning, head to the Auckland Zoo and get up close with a diverse range of animals. Afterward, visit the interactive exhibits at the Auckland Museum to learn about the country's rich history and Maori culture. In the evening, take a stroll along the iconic waterfront of Viaduct Harbour and enjoy a delicious dinner at one of the family-friendly restaurants.

  • Auckland Zoo: Cost estimate - $30 per adult, $15 per child |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Auckland Museum: Cost estimate - $25 per adult, free for children under 15 |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Viaduct Harbour: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- Evening
Tuesday, January 23: Adventurous Excursions in Rotorua

Embark on an unforgettable adventure in Rotorua. Start your morning with a visit to Te Puia, where you can witness the impressive geothermal activity and experience the Maori cultural performances. In the afternoon, head to the Redwoods Forest and indulge in an exhilarating treetop walk or ziplining experience. In the evening, relax at the Polynesian Spa, known for its soothing hot mineral pools.

  • Te Puia: Cost estimate - $60 per adult, $30 per child |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Redwoods Forest: Cost estimate - $30 per adult, $15 per child |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Polynesian Spa: Cost estimate - $35 per adult, $20 per child | Time spent - Evening
Wednesday, January 24: Exploring the Magical Glowworm Caves in Waitomo

Discover the enchanting glowworm caves in Waitomo. Take a guided boat tour through the Waitomo Glowworm Caves and marvel at the mesmerizing glow emitted by thousands of tiny glowworms. In the afternoon, visit the Ruakuri Cave and explore its stunning limestone formations. End your day with a relaxing walk through the beautiful Waitomo Forest.

  • Waitomo Glowworm Caves: Cost estimate - $50 per adult, $25 per child |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Ruakuri Cave: Cost estimate - $43 per adult, $20 per child |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Waitomo Forest Walk: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- Evening
Thursday, January 25: Adventure and Nature in Queenstown

Head to the adventure capital, Queenstown. In the morning, take a thrilling jet boat ride on the Shotover River, experiencing adrenaline-pumping spins and stunning scenery. Afterward, visit the Kiwi Birdlife Park and get a chance to see New Zealand's national bird up close. In the evening, take a relaxing cruise on Lake Wakatipu and enjoy the breathtaking views.

  • Shotover Jet: Cost estimate - $140 per adult, $80 per child |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Kiwi Birdlife Park: Cost estimate - $50 per adult, $25 per child |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Lake Wakatipu Cruise: Cost estimate - $50 per adult, $25 per child | Time spent - Evening
Friday, January 26: Discovering the Fiordland National Park in Milford Sound

Embark on a scenic journey to Milford Sound, located within the Fiordland National Park. Take a cruise through the awe-inspiring fjords and witness cascading waterfalls, towering cliffs, and abundant wildlife. In the afternoon, hike along the Milford Foreshore Walk and enjoy the picturesque views. Spend the evening stargazing and marveling at the pristine night sky.

  • Milford Sound Cruise: Cost estimate - $80 per adult, $40 per child |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Milford Foreshore Walk: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Stargazing: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- Evening
Saturday, January 27: Cultural Experiences in Wellington

Visit New Zealand's capital city, Wellington, and immerse yourself in its rich cultural offerings. Begin your day by exploring the Te Papa Tongarewa Museum, home to fascinating exhibitions showcasing the country's art, history, and natural treasures. In the afternoon, take a ride on the iconic Wellington Cable Car to enjoy panoramic views of the city. End your day with a stroll around the vibrant waterfront promenade.

  • Te Papa Tongarewa Museum: Cost estimate - Free (donations welcome) |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Wellington Cable Car: Cost estimate - $7 per adult, $3.50 per child |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Waterfront Promenade: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- Evening
Sunday, January 28: Leisure Day in Christchurch

Spend your last day in Christchurch at a relaxed pace. In the morning, visit the Christchurch Botanic Gardens and enjoy the beautiful surroundings. Afterward, explore the International Antarctic Centre, where you can experience an Antarctic storm and interact with penguins. In the evening, take a leisurely punt ride along the tranquil Avon River.

  • Christchurch Botanic Gardens: Cost estimate - Free |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• International Antarctic Centre: Cost estimate - $60 per adult, $30 per child |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Avon River Punt Ride: Cost estimate - $30 per adult, $15 per child | Time spent - Evening

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ions and places loved by locals, don't miss the Hobbiton Movie Set near Matamata, where you can explore the charming village of Hobbiton from "The Lord of the Rings" and "The Hobbit" movies. Additionally, visit the Wai-O-Tapu Thermal Wonderland, known for its colorful geothermal pools, mud pools, and volcanic activity. Both these attractions offer unique experiences for the whole family.
